Embroker is seeking a highly skilled and experienced to lead our data management initiatives. This role is integral to managing and leveraging our proprietary MGA data and third-party carrier Brokerage data. The will work closely with our Data Engineering and Pricing & Analytics teams to rebuild and enhance our management and financial reporting data infrastructure. This role will also involve designing comprehensive data documentation and governance processes, ensuring seamless integration of corporate and product changes, and scoping out the integration of new Business Intelligence tools.

  • Lead the overhaul and reconstruction of management and financial reporting data warehouse with stakeholders across the business (Product, Marketing, Insurance, Sales & Operations) to drive consistent reporting and analysis
  • Collaborate with Data Engineering and Pricing & Analytics teams to ensure data accuracy, consistency, and integrity in all reporting tables
  • Develop and implement robust data documentation and governance practices for each data field and all reporting tables
  • Ensure corporate and product changes are effectively integrated into newly designed data structures and reporting tables
  • Scope out and manage the integration of new Business Intelligence tools in collaboration with the Pricing & Analytics team to enhance data reporting and analytics capabilities
  • Monitor and maintain data quality, providing regular audits and ensuring compliance with industry standards and regulations
  • Provide strategic data build recommendations based on past, expert insurance data management experience to ensure all departments can make data-driven decisions
  • Act as the primary point of contact for data-related queries and issues, offering expert guidance and solutions
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ives within the data management function to optimize processes and enhance data utilization

What We Do

Embroker is enhancing the legacy manually intensive technology of the commercial insurance industry with an end-to-end insurance platform that intelligently recommends industry-tailored coverage programs, all in minutes.

Single Destination:
Businesses no longer need to shop for or purchase coverage from multiple sources. Embroker is creating recommended industry-tailored coverage programs, purchased through a single application experience.

Industry-tailored, Curated:
Embroker eliminates the need to choose a one-size-fits-all policy. We provide coverage options curated to meet the needs of business industries that are tailored to specific risk profiles.

Industry Expert-Informed Platform:
The Embroker ONE platform is built in collaboration with commercial insurance industry experts to create a digital broker experience. Our platform technology saves businesses time and increases confidence when purchasing commercial insurance for their businesses.
